Aftermath of the 1857 Uprising: A Shift in Colonial Dynamics

This chapter explores the impact of the 1857 uprising in India, detailing the transition from East India Company rule to direct British governance. It highlights the resulting cultural and military shifts, as well as the growing tensions and disillusionment among Indians leading up to 1919. Through the lives of key figures like Ghalib and Sir Michael O'Dwyer, it illustrates the complex interactions between British authority and Indian identity during this transformative period.
